Abstract

Methods of digital data processing support performing user-defined actions on multiple data records in order to update those records and/or to create new records and/or post communication to email or social network platforms. Such methods can include receiving definitions of records and of actions to perform with respect to them. Those methods can further include determining default values for data fields of records to create or update during performance of a selected such action with respect to the multiple selected data records, and populating those records and/or communications with those values.
